#ef0246 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ef0246 is composed of 93.7% red, 0.8%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.2% magenta, 70.7%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 342.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 47.3%. #ef0246 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ff048c with #df0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

Shades and Tints of #ef0246

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060002 is the darkest color, while #fff1f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ef0246

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#807175 is the less saturated color, while #ef0246 is the most saturated one.
